3,000 تومان
آموزش آلتیوم دیزاینر
Altium Designer یکی از بهترین نرم افزار طراحی مدارات چاپی است. این نرم افزار توانایی طراحی چند لایه ای PCB در محیط دو بعدی و همچنین سه بعدی را دارد. در آلتیوم شما می توانید یک شماتیک طراحی کرده و به راحتی آن را به PCB تبدیل کنید. البته بیشتر دوستان در ایران راه سخت تر را انتخاب می کنند و بوسیله تعریف نتِ ها PCB را طراحی می کنند که قاعدتا مشکلات پس از طراحی و در زمان ساخت، عیب یابی و تغییر PCB نمایان می شود. در طراحی پی سی بی قطعات الکترونیکی می توانند در قسمت زیر و روی برد مدار چاپی قرار بگیرند. نرم افزار Altium به شما این قابلیت را می دهد تا پایه های این قطعات را به صورت اتوماتیک یا تعاملی (Interactive) در هر لایه ای از PCB به یکدیگر متصل کنید که به اصطلاح به این کار Routing گفته می شود. با استفاده از PCB Rules در طراحی مدار چاپی در Altium Designer می توانید قوانین مختلفی را تعریف کنید تا از بروز خطا جلوگیری کرده و یک مدار استاندارد را طراحی کنید. برای مثال می توانید در قسمت PCB Rules حداقل و حداکثر پهنای Track (اتصال رسانا بین پین های قطعات)، حداقل فاصله قطعات و Track ها و … را تعیین کنید.
علیرضا عبادی
3,000 تومان
آموزش زبان سی
آموزش کامل برنامه نویسی سی برای میکرو پیشگفتار میکروکنترلر یک تراشه الکترونیکی قابل برنامه ریزی است که استفاده از آن باعث افزایش سرعت و کارآیی مدار در مقابل کاهش حجم و هزینه مدار می گردد. با ساخت میکروکنترلرها تحول شگرفی در ساخت تجهیزات الکترونیکی نظیر لوازم خانگی ، صنعتی ، پزشکی ، تجاری و ... به وجود آمده است که بدون آن تصور تجهیزات و وسایل پیشرفته امروزی غیر ممکن است. یکی از میکروکنترلرهای پرکاربرد و معروف AVR نام دارد که ساخت شرکت Atmel می باشد. این میکروکنترلرها جزو ساده ترین و در عین حال پر کاربرد ترین میکروکنترلرهای موجود می باشد. از میکروکنترلرهای AVR در کاربردهایی وسیع با قابلیت های متوسط ( مانند پروژه های دانشگاهی، تجاری، منازل و… ) استفاده می گردد. اولین و بهترین گزینه برای ورود به دنیای الکترونیک دیجیتال، یاد گرفتن میکروکنترلرهای AVR است چرا که اصولی ترین و پایه ای ترین مباحث الکترونیک دیجیتال در آموزش این میکروکنترلرها وجود دارد که به عنوان پیش نیازی برای یادگیری سطوح بالاتر و میکروکنترلرهای قوی تر همانند ARM و آرایه های منطقی برنامه پذیر FPGA است. یادگیری این میکروکنترلرها بسیار شیرین بوده و پروژه های بسیار جالب و پرکاربردی با استفاده از آنها میتوان خلق کرد. همچنین تهیه این میکروکنترلرها بسیار راحت تر و قیمت آن نسبت به بقیه میکروکنترلرها بسیار مناسب بوده و همه علاقه مندان میتوانند لوازم مورد نیاز آن ها را تهیه و به راحتی استفاده نمایند. خوشبختانه منابع گسترده و وسیعی در اینترنت برای یادگیری میکروکنترلرهای AVR وجود دارد که بسیار در این زمینه کمک می کنند اما به علت اینکه اغلب با نگاه سطحی یا بسیار عمیق گفته شده اند، یا جوابگوی کلیه نیارهای علاقه مندان و مشتاقان یادگیری نیست و یا فقط قشر خاصی توانایی درک و هضم آن را دارند. جزوه موجود که با نگاهی نو برای مخاطب عام و با زبانی ساده بیان شده است، امید است بتواند به طور عمیق و مفهومی نظر خوانندگان را به این حوزه جلب کند. ضمنا ویژگی دیگر این جزوه از 0 تا 100 بودن آن است یعنی سعی شده است تمام قواعد و قوانین مورد نیاز برای کار، از رنگ مقاومت ها گرفته تا فرمول های مورد نیاز برای طراحی پروژه های میکروکنترلری، آورده شده باشد تا در هر زمان و در هر مکان برای کار با میکروکنترلرهای AVR فقط به این جزوه نیاز داشته باشید.
علیرضا عبادی